About this earthquake

A magnitude M4.5 earthquake was recorded near Tahua, Potosí (Bolivia) on July 1, 2026 at 08:00 UTC. At around 171 km, the focal depth places this among intermediate-depth events. Tremors of this size are distinctly felt and can occasionally cause light damage.

Why depth matters

Intermediate-depth quakes are felt across a wider area but usually cause less surface damage.
